ZEUS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2013 in Review
114 of the 3,447 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Olympic Steel (ZEUS) for Q4 2013, worth a combined $230M — up 4.9% from $219M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 12 funds opened new ZEUS positions and 6 closed out — a net gain of 6 holders — while 40 added to existing stakes and 39 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Killen Group, adding an estimated $4.73M. The largest seller was Heartland Advisors, cutting an estimated $5.6M.
